Southall Avenue is a residential location in the village of Skewen which is a small community located approximately 5 miles northeast of the town of Neath. The property is a ground floor flat with convenient access to local amenities, schools, colleges, and the M4 corridor. Its an ideal investment opportunity or suitable for first-time buyers.

The flat features a well-maintained interior and offers spacious accommodation. The layout includes an entrance hallway, a generously sized lounge that opens up to the kitchen in an open-plan arrangement, two double bedrooms, and a family bathroom. Additionally, the property includes communal garden and a small courtyard area. These shared outdoor spaces can be enjoyed by the residents and there is also a storage shed available in a separate out building.

Main Dwelling -

Entrance Hallway - 5.125 x 0.937 (16'9" x 3'0") - With laminate floor, coved ceiling and radiator.

Lounge - 4.210 x 3.797 (13'9" x 12'5") - Attractive room with open plan area to kitchen, two windows to front, coved ceiling and radiator.

Kitchen - 2.318 x 2.24 (7'7" x 7'4") - Fitted with sage Green colour units with matt black handles, built-in gas cooker with electric oven, storage are housing the Baxi boiler, sink drainer with mixer taps, part tiled to walls, cushion flooring, window to front and opening to lounge area.

Bedroom One - 3.935 x 3.008 (12'10" x 9'10") - Double room with built-in storage with shelves, window to front and radiator.

Bedroom Two - 3.840 x 1.950 (12'7" x 6'4") - With window to front and radiator.

Bathroom - Fitted suite to include; panel bath with shower mixer taps, low level WC, tiled to walls, tiled effect cushion flooring, window to side and radiator.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
